About United Cerebral Palsy Association of San Diego County
Agency Background and Mission: The mission of United Cerebral Palsy Association of San Diego County is to advance the independence, productivity and full citizenship of people affected by cerebral palsy and other disabilities. United Cerebral Palsy of San Diego was established in 1958 by parents of children with cerebral palsy who wanted to keep their child at home and out of institutional care while also promoting a better understanding of cerebral palsy to the public at large. Since that time we have served the San Diego community with a variety of programs and services for over 63 years. UCP of San Diego exists to provide services, information, advocacy and support to people with disabilities of all ages and to their families. We are a focal point for information on cerebral palsy and related services at a local level. We are also an affiliate of our national organization, UCPA, Inc., located in Washington, D.C. Our Assistive Technology Center is also part of the California state-wide program called the “Ability Tools Network” which consists of community based assistive technology centers similar to ours who provide free AT equipment loans to anyone in need. In order to meet our mission, UCP of San Diego provides the following services to San Diego County: adult occupational skill training and supported employment services, adult day programs, Project College for college-bound students with disabilities, a toy and software lending library, an assistive technology center, respite for parents, information and referral services, grant funding to individuals with unmet needs and recycling of durable medical equipment. During the last year, we provided services to 5,774 people including children, adolescents and adults with disabilities, their families, educators, college students in special education and to other professionals who work with this population.
